The location of this place is great! Close to so many restaurants, shops and the Duomo. About a 5- minute walk to the main beach area or 3 minutes if you are ok to be in the smaller beach area by the old town walls. The rooms look like the photos. Mauro checked us in. He doesn't speak English really but we were able to communicate. Breakfast in from 8:30-9:30am. Mauro sets out a nice little breakfast with meats, cheese, eggs and pastries. Adorable family run bed and breakfast in the heart of historic center on one of the oldest streets in Cefalu. Mauro was super kind and flexible, ensuring I was happy with every aspect of the stay. He makes you feel part of the family! His homemade breakfast goodies - cakes, yogurt, jams, etc. are top notch and he makes any kind of omelette and coffee you like. The house itself is very unique and has ancient frescoes painted on the ceiling. Within a minute you can be at the beach or the piazza with the cathedral. Really charming and adorable place that is lovingly managed! I had a really sweet time. Grazie mille!!!!

Apart from the rooms, that are somewhat small, but clean and with a contemporary touch, the rest of the hotel is not up to standard. No lobby/lounge area. There is a breakfast area that is very dark. The host, Maurio, is very annoying and tries to convince the guests, if booked via booking.com or other booking services, to cancel their booking and instead pay directly to him in exchange for a minimal discount. He ialso get upset and put nasty and rude comments if you do not finish all items on the breakfast plate, talk to loud, do not put out the light, not closing the door, or closing it to loudly… etc. etc. Overall a terrible stay!
